Coast Guard pilot Lt.j.g. Jason Evans, from Coast Guard Air Station Elizabeth City, N.C., performs pre-flight checks aboard a HH-60 Jayhawk rescue helicopter before taking off from Coast Guard Air Station New Orleans to conduct overflight damage assessments and search and rescue operations, Sept. 13, 2008 following the landfall of Hurricane Ike. The Coast Guard deployed additional search and rescue aircraft from numerous air stations from throughout the Coast Guard to aid in search and rescue response for the citizens of Texas and Louisiana.
